Automotive Engineering Advancements

The automotive industry is constantly evolving, driven by significant advancements in engineering. Several of the most prominent areas of progress include hybrid and electric vehicle technologies, autonomous driving systems, and lightweight constructions. These developments are revolutionizing the way we approach, build, and use vehicles.

Moreover, engineers are pushing the boundaries of vehicle safety through cutting-edge driver assistance systems and collision avoidance technologies. These advancements aim to decrease accidents and boost overall road safety.

The future of automotive engineering is optimistic, with ongoing research and development efforts focused on fuel economy, emission reduction, and network integration. These endeavors hold the potential to develop a new era of smarter, safer, and more eco-friendly vehicles.

Hitting the Road Journey: A Detailed Guide

Before you hit on your next road voyage, make sure you're ready. Packing the right items can make a smooth experience.

  • Develop a detailed itinerary that includes your stops, accommodation, and food plans.
  • Carry essentials like a emergency kit, navigation system, headlamp, and extra garments in case of unfavorable weather.
  • Maintain your vehicle in top condition. Inspect your tires, oil levels, and other fluids before you leave.
  • Download offline maps and music in case of poor cell service.

Bringing Back the Chrome

Diving into a vintage car restoration is a labor of love, requiring persistence and a keen eye for detail. Before you even crack open that dusty hood, it's essential to pinpoint the make and its specific features. A thorough inspection will help you assess the extent of work needed, from basic cosmetic repairs to more involved mechanical refurbishments.

This Electric Vehicle Revolution: A Future of Mobility

The automotive industry is on the cusp of a monumental transformation, propelled by the rapid rise of electric vehicles (EVs). These zero-emission marvels are not just a passing fad; they represent a paradigm shift in how we think about and interact with transportation. People are increasingly gravitating towards EVs, driven by their environmental benefits, performance capabilities, and cost savings in the long run. Governments worldwide are enacting policies to support EV adoption, recognizing their crucial role in combating climate change. The future of mobility is electric, and it's arriving faster than many predicted.

The Science Behind a Car's Engine

A car engine is a complex system that converts fuel energy into mechanical power. This process involves several fundamental components working in synchronization. Fuel and air are blended inside the cylinders, where they are exploded by a spark plug. The resulting explosion propels a piston, which in turn spins a crankshaft. This rotational motion is then transmitted to the wheels through a series of gears and axles, ultimately allowing the car to operate.

  • Moreover, the engine also needs to be tempered to prevent overheating. This is achieved by a radiator system that circulates coolant through the engine, absorbing excess heat.
  • Likewise, the fuel system plays a vital role in delivering the optimal amount of fuel to the cylinders. It manages the flow of fuel based on engine speed and load.

Understanding these fundamental concepts can help you better appreciate the intricate workings of a car engine and its importance in modern transportation.
